Maintain a level head position - The height of the hurdler's head position should never deviate whether they are on or off of the hurdle. There is no up & down motion. The head maintains a straight level line throughout the race.

From here, take your right leg and bend it at the knee as you pull it round to the … getting around tokyo by trainchristopher artinian booksWebHow to Set Up. Arrange 5 agility hurdles 3-5 feet apart. This soccer agility training can be done using hurdles of any size. Depending on your fitness level and experience, you may start with mini-hurdles and work your way up to waist-level hurdles. How to Execute.
